Salary of Human Resource Management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$55,826 Bachelor's Median Salary

Human Resource Management graduates with a bachelor’s degree from WSU report a median salary of $55,826 a year. This is higher than $52,641, the median for all majors at WSU.

Student Debt of Human Resource Management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$21,570 Bachelor's Median Debt

To complete a bachelor’s at WSU, human resource management graduates take on a median debt of $21,570 in student loans. This is lower than $24,307, the typical median for all majors at WSU.
